Overview of H&M and Armani
H&M, a Swedish multinational clothing retail company, is known for its fast-fashion model, offering trendy apparel at affordable prices. The brand has made strides in sustainability, aiming to use more sustainable materials and improve its production processes. In contrast, Armani, an Italian luxury fashion house, emphasizes high-quality materials and craftsmanship, often at a premium price point. The brand is synonymous with luxury and sophistication, targeting a more affluent clientele.
Materials Used
H&M
H&M has been increasingly focusing on sustainable materials in its collections. As of 2025, a significant portion of H&M's clothing is made from organic cotton, recycled polyester, and other eco-friendly fabrics. The brand has committed to using 100% sustainably sourced cotton by 2025, which reflects its dedication to reducing environmental impact. However, the quality of materials can vary widely across different product lines, with some items being more durable than others.
Armani
Armani, on the other hand, is known for its luxurious fabrics, including high-grade wool, silk, and cashmere. The brand's commitment to quality is evident in its meticulous selection of materials, which are designed to offer both comfort and longevity. Armani's products often feature detailed craftsmanship, which contributes to their overall quality and appeal. While the price point is significantly higher than H&M, many customers justify the investment due to the superior materials used.
Durability
H&M
Durability is a common concern in the fast-fashion industry, and H&M is no exception. While the brand has made efforts to improve the longevity of its products, many customers report mixed experiences. Some items may wear out quickly, especially those made from lower-quality materials or those that follow the latest fashion trends. However, H&M has introduced lines that focus on durability, providing consumers with options that last longer than traditional fast-fashion items.
Armani
In contrast, Armani's emphasis on quality ensures that its products are generally more durable. Many customers find that Armani pieces withstand the test of time, both in terms of style and wear. The brand's commitment to craftsmanship means that its clothing often features reinforced stitching and high-quality finishes, which contribute to a longer lifespan. While the initial investment is higher, many consumers find that Armani pieces are worth the price due to their durability.
Customer Feedback
H&M
Customer feedback for H&M is varied. Many appreciate the affordability and trendy styles the brand offers, making it accessible to a wide audience. However, there are frequent complaints regarding the quality of certain items, particularly in the lower price ranges. Customers often express disappointment when items do not hold up after a few washes or when seams come undone. On the positive side, H&M's efforts in sustainability have garnered praise from environmentally-conscious consumers.
Armani
Armani generally receives positive feedback regarding the quality of its products. Customers often highlight the luxurious feel of the fabrics and the attention to detail in the craftsmanship. While some may find the prices steep, many loyal customers believe the investment is justified by the quality and longevity of the items. Negative feedback is less common but may include comments about sizing inconsistencies or the high cost of alterations for tailored pieces.
Pricing Differences
The pricing strategies of H&M and Armani reflect their target markets. H&M's prices are designed to be accessible, with most items falling within a budget-friendly range. This makes it possible for consumers to purchase multiple trendy pieces without breaking the bank. In contrast, Armani's pricing reflects its luxury branding, with many items priced significantly higher. This distinction not only affects consumer perception but also influences the overall shopping experience, with H&M positioned as a quick, casual shopping destination and Armani as a more exclusive, luxury experience.
Sustainability Practices
Both brands have made commitments to sustainability, but their approaches differ significantly. H&M has implemented various initiatives aimed at reducing its environmental footprint, including recycling programs and the use of sustainable materials. The brand's transparency about its sustainability efforts has been a focal point in its marketing strategy.
Armani has also taken steps towards sustainability, with initiatives focused on reducing waste and promoting ethical production practices. However, the brand's luxury positioning means that its sustainability efforts are often perceived through a different lens, with a focus on high-quality, long-lasting products that reduce the need for frequent replacement.
